Frequently asked questions about Burney Junior-Senior High
How many students attend Burney Junior-Senior High?
Burney Junior-Senior High has 231 students enrolled. It is a public school in Burney, CA. CCD year-over-year: 238 (2022-23) → 246 (2023-24), nearly flat (+8).
What is the student-teacher ratio at Burney Junior-Senior High?
The student-teacher ratio at Burney Junior-Senior High is 15.4:1, which is 28% lower than the California average of 21.5:1 and 2%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Burney Junior-Senior High?
49.6% of students at Burney Junior-Senior High are eligible for free lunch, compared to the California average of 55.5%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Burney Junior-Senior High?
The largest demographic group at Burney Junior-Senior High is White at 56.3% of enrollment, in Burney, CA.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 61.2/100.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Burney Junior-Senior High?
Burney Junior-Senior High has a Resource Investment Index of 17/100 (lower re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ism.
